What is an intentional act of causing physical self-harm or intending to cause physical self-harm without the intent to kill oneself?

The intentional act of causing physical self-harm without intending to cause death is often referred to as self-harm or non-suicidal self-injury. This behavior is driven by various factors such as emotional distress, coping mechanisms, or a way to communicate inner pain without the intent to end one's life. It is essential for individuals engaging in self-harm to seek professional help and support to address underlying issues and develop healthier coping strategies.

Do only phsychos do self mutilation or is it also practiced by normal people?

Self-mutilation, also known as self-harm, can be practiced by individuals with various mental health conditions, such as depression, anxiety, or borderline personality disorder. It is not limited to "psychos" but is a behavior often used as a coping mechanism or a way to express emotional distress by individuals facing challenges in their lives. Seeking help from a mental health professional is important for addressing the underlying issues leading to self-harm.
